The
Tai
Po
Waterfront
Park
is
a
22
hectare
city
park
situated
on
the
northern
shore
of
the
Tolo
Harbour.
It
opened
to
the
public
in
1997
and
affords
residents
of
Tai
Po
with
well
maintained
and
managed
leisure
and
recreation
space
with
good
facilities
and
rewarding
views
of
the
harbour.
Quite
a
few
buses
call
upon
the
park
including
those
from
the
Tai
Po
Market
MTR
Station.
You
can
also
walk
there
from
the
station
in
20-25
minutes.
This
is
also
a
major
stop
on
the
very
popular
Tai
Wan
to
Tai
Mei
Tuk
bike
trail.
The
Waterfront
Park
has
quite
a
lot
to
offer.
There
is
expected
grassy
areas,
children's
playground
areas,
elderly
fitness
equipment,
pebble
walking
trails,
kite
flying
area,
model
boat
pool,
an
insect
house,
sculpture
installations,
public
toilets,
bike
rentals
and
parking
areas
and
loads
of
promenade
space
directly
on
the
sea.
A
real
highlight
to
visiting
the
Waterfront
Park
is
the
spiral-shaped
lookout
tower
that
is
just
over
32
metres
in
heigth,
affording
visitors
really
nice
panoramic
views
of
the
harbour,
nearby
industrial
park,
the
mountainous
areas
beyond
Tai
Po
as
well
as
the
rest
of
the
park,
surrounding
the
lookout
tower.
